Dr. Selman Waksman in Rutgers University Lab
(Original Caption) 10/23/1952-New Brunswick, NJ- Dr. Selman A. Waksman shown at work in his Rutgers University laboratory, was awarded the Nobel Prize for Medicine and Physiology tonight by the Council of the Caroline Institute of the University of Stockholm for his work in the discovery of Streptomycin.The prize, about $33,200 this year was awarded to the microbiologist for his work in dicovering the first effective Antibiotic for use against Tuberculosis.
